Product Description:

The 19.R6.S1E-900A Regen Unit is an important part of the R6 Combivert Line Regen Series. It is manufactured by KEB which is an experienced company in the line of industrial automation. This unit is intended for the optimization of power which ensures energy recovery and reduces overall energy consumption.

The 19.R6.S1E-900A Regen Unit has a rated input power of 44 kW and a maximum input capacity of 72 kW. It makes this type well-suited for high-load processes. This relay has a rated supply current of 70 A and a DC supply current of 87 A. It is designed for 3 phase power supply having a voltage of 400 volts AC and comes with 2 frequency bands 50 Hz/60 Hz. The 19.R6.S1E-900A Regen Unit has a maximum active power output of 67 kW which is well suited for large power loads without compromising on its stability. This makes it perfect for energy regeneration where efficiency and reliability are of the essence. This device also assists in making systems efficient by converting excessive braking power into usable power output. Its design is more flexible than a conventional power station, which helps reduce energy losses across services and boost sustainable operations. The installation of this unit is relatively simple and integration with other systems is seamless. That is why, its adoption can be considered practical for companies interested in strengthening energy recovery operations.

The 19.R6.S1E-900A Regen Unit dimensions are 130mm (W) x 290mm (H) x 208mm (D) and it has a total weight of only 5.6kg. Such compact dimensions can be easily incorporated into existing setups while minimum changes in the system may be needed. The overload limit of the unit is set at 160% and this means that there is an extra margin for power surge during the operation of the unit.
